I'm working on the tailgate torque rods on my 1973 K5 Blazer, and I'm having trouble getting them correctly anchored to the frame-side brackets.
My Setup & The Problem:

- My factory triangular frame brackets are mounted, but the holes where the anchor pins are supposed to live are completely unthreaded.
- The original pins were missing, so I tried using a standard hardware-store shoulder bolt (pushed through from the back) and a hex nut to hold the rod loop on.
- The issue: The torque rod loop doesn't want to stay on the shoulder bolt when I open the tailgate. It seems like the rod isn't twisting cleanly or it binds, forcing the loop to walk sideways and pop right off the bolt/nut.
